Career
He plays for the Queensland Blades in the Australian Hockey League. He made his debut for the Australia men"s national field hockey team in 2009 during a five game test series in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. Gohdes is from Rockhampton, Queensland.

Gohdes plays in the Australian Hockey League for the Queensland Blades. In 2010, he played in the final game of the season for his state team in the Australian Hockey League.
He played for the Queensland Blades in the first found of the 2011 season. He currently plays for the Delhi Waveriders in the Hockey India League
In 2009, Gohdes, Jonathon Charlesworth and Brent Dancer made their national team debut during a five game test series in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ia against Malaysia.
In December 2011, he was named as one of twenty-eight players to be on the 2012 Summer Olympics Australian men"s national training squad.
This squad will be narrowed in June 2012. He trained with the team from 18 January to mid-March in Perth, Western Australia. In February during the training camp, he played in a four nations test series with the teams being the Kookaburras, Australia A Squad, the Netherlands and Argentina.
He played for the Kookaburras in their 3–1 victory over the Australian A team in the first round of the competition.
He scored the team"s first goal in the first five minutes of the game. He later scored the team"s third goal.
